Self-Seal® Type-SSC Collars – 6″
Self-Seal® Type-SSC can be used to firestop solid or cellular core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C), solid or cellular core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ene (ABS), XFR 15-50 PVC, Chlorinated Polyvinyl Chloride (CPVC), and Flame Retardant Polypropylene (FRPP) closed or vented pipe penetrations. Solid core PVC, XFR 15-50 PVC vented and CPV sprinkler pipe penetrations firestopped with Self-Seal® Type-SSC meet the Canadian building code test requirement for a pressure differential of 50 Pa between the exposed and unexposed sides of concrete, drywall and wood floor-ceiling fire-rated assemblies.
